Solution Overview
Problem
The current methods for parking a motor vehicle in urban areas are inconvenient, requiring users to purchase and handle parking tickets or use parking discs, which are perceived as laborious and environmentally unfriendly.
Innovation Solution
A motor vehicle equipped with a permanently integrated device, such as an electrical display or lighting unit, for displaying parking duration and start, eliminating the need for physical tickets or discs, and allowing for automatic billing through an electronic evaluation system using GPS and sensors.
Engineering Contradictions & Design Principles
Engineering Contradiction Analysis
1Ease of operation
If a parking ticket machine or parking disc is used, then parking information can be displayed, but user convenience deteriorates due to the need to leave the vehicle, handle physical tickets, or manually set and arrange parking discs
Solution Approach 1:
The patent replaces mechanical parking information systems (physical tickets, parking discs) with an electronic display system integrated into the vehicle. The display device electronically shows parking duration and start time, eliminating the need for mechanical ticket handling or manual disc arrangement, thus improving convenience while reducing operational complexity.
Solution Approach 2:
The integrated display system automatically provides parking information without requiring user intervention to obtain or arrange physical tickets. The system serves itself by internally managing and displaying parking data, freeing the user from leaving the vehicle or manually handling parking accessories.
2Object-generated harmful factors
If physical parking tickets and discs are used, then parking information can be communicated, but environmental friendliness deteriorates due to plastic waste from tickets and discs
Solution Approach 1:
The patent substitutes physical parking tickets and discs made of plastic with an electronic display system. This replacement eliminates the generation of plastic waste associated with traditional parking methods while the electronic system provides the same information communication function, thereby reducing harmful environmental factors.
Solution Approach 2:
The invention changes the physical state of parking information from tangible plastic objects to intangible electronic data. By transforming the medium from physical (plastic tickets/discs) to digital (electronic display), the system eliminates material waste while maintaining information delivery capability.
3Loss of time
If parking tickets are purchased at a ticket machine, then parking authorization is obtained, but time consumption increases due to leaving the vehicle and handling cash or small change
Solution Approach 1:
The system performs preliminary action by automatically obtaining and storing parking authorization data before the user needs to view it. The display system is pre-configured to show parking duration and start time without requiring the user to first purchase a ticket, thus eliminating the time-consuming sequence of leaving the vehicle, buying a ticket, and then returning to view it.
Solution Approach 2:
The patent replaces the mechanical process of visiting a ticket machine, handling cash or change, and physically obtaining a ticket with an electronic system that automatically manages parking authorization and displays information, significantly reducing the time required to complete the parking operation.

The invention relates to a motor vehicle (1). In order to increase motor vehicle user convenience and eco-friendliness in connection with a parking of motor vehicles (1) subject to a charge, the motor vehicle (1) has at least one device (2) permanently integrated into at least one structure of the motor vehicle (1) for displaying a parking duration and/or a parking start of the motor vehicle.
